Song Meaning
The lyrics to "This Is Sarah's Song" immediately convey an intense, all-consuming devotion. The speaker declares a profound commitment, stating, "This is what I wanna live for" and "This is where I wanna live." It's a powerful, present-tense affirmation of purpose and belonging.
A central tension in the lyrics lies in the speaker's absolute certainty about the feeling's existence, contrasted with an explicit acceptance of its undefined nature. The repeated phrase "No matter what this is" underscores a willingness to embrace the emotion fully, without needing to label or explain it. The speaker prioritizes raw, authentic experience over intellectual understanding, stating, "I only wanna know it's real."
The craft here is driven by relentless, almost mantra-like repetition. Phrases like "This is" and "never let it go away" build an insistent, spiritual devotion. The speaker's willingness to "give my life to you and to this feeling" elevates the emotion beyond simple romance, suggesting a profound, all-encompassing purpose that defines their very existence.
These lyrics resonate because they tap into a universal human desire for something undeniably real and worth living for, even if it defies easy categorization. The speaker's unshakeable conviction, culminating in the declaration "It's everything that is," transforms a personal vow into an existential statement, making the feeling itself the ultimate truth.
